The Complexities of Coma Understanding a Mysterious State of Consciousness


Coma is a perplexing medical condition, often characterized by a prolonged state of unconsciousness, where a person is unresponsive to their environment. While most of us can readily recognize the term coma from media portrayals or conversations surrounding serious illnesses, the reality of this state is far more intricate. In exploring the nuances of coma, we delve into its causes, implications, and the profound mysteries of consciousness.


At its core, a coma is a state where an individual fails to respond to external stimuli, lacks awareness, and demonstrates an absence of purposeful behavior. This condition can be precipitated by a myriad of factors, including traumatic brain injuries, strokes, overdoses, or severe illnesses that affect the brain’s ability to function normally. The severity and duration of a coma can vary significantly; some individuals may emerge after days or weeks, while others may remain in a vegetative state for years or even indefinitely.


One of the most critical aspects of understanding coma lies in grasping the underlying mechanisms that lead to this altered state of consciousness. The brain is an incredibly complex organ, with different regions responsible for various functions such as movement, sensation, and cognitive processing. When a traumatic event occurs, it can disrupt the normal functioning of these areas. For instance, a blunt force trauma to the head may cause diffuse axonal injury, where the nerve fibers are stretched or sheared, leading to a breakdown in communication within the brain.


Neuroscience has made significant strides in unraveling the complexities of the comatose state. Advanced imaging techniques, such as functional MRI and EEG, allow researchers to observe brain activity in individuals diagnosed as being in a coma. Interestingly, these studies have revealed that even in states of unresponsiveness, some brain regions may remain active, suggesting that the potential for consciousness could still exist. This remarkable finding raises philosophical and ethical questions about the essence of consciousness and what it means to be aware.

The prognosis for individuals in a coma can be quite grim, and discussions regarding the potential for recovery often become a sensitive topic among family members and medical professionals. Factors such as the duration of the coma, the cause of the unconsciousness, and the age and overall health of the patient play critical roles in determining the likelihood of regaining consciousness. In some cases, families must navigate difficult decisions regarding life support and end-of-life care, highlighting the emotional turmoil that often accompanies such medical scenarios.


In recent years, there have been notable cases where individuals have emerged from coma after extended periods, sometimes with surprising cognitive and physical abilities. One such instance involved Martin Pistorius, who fell into a coma as a child and reported being aware of his surroundings despite being unable to communicate. His subsequent recovery offered a glimpse into the complexities of consciousness and sparked discussions on the ethics of treatment and patient care.


Moving beyond the medical perspective, the emotional and psychological impact of coma on family members and caregivers cannot be overstated. Witnessing a loved one in such a vulnerable state can induce feelings of helplessness, despair, and anxiety. Many families find themselves grappling with uncertainty and hope, oscillating between the desire for recovery and the acceptance of a potential loss. Support groups and counseling services can provide vital resources to help families cope with the emotional toll associated with prolonged illness.
